NVIDIA

P104-100

The P104-100 is manufactured by NVIDIA. It was released in December 12 2017. It features the Pascal architecture. The core clock ranges from 1607 MHz to 1733 MHz. It has 1920 shading units. The thermal design power (TDP) is 30W. Manufactured using 16 nm process technology. G3D Mark benchmark score: 3,678 points.

AMD

Radeon HD 7970M

The Radeon HD 7970M is manufactured by AMD. It was released in April 24 2012. It features the GCN 1.0 architecture. The core clock speed is 850 MHz. It has 1280 shading units. The thermal design power (TDP) is 100W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 3,663 points.

Graphics Performance

The P104-100 scores 3,678 and the Radeon HD 7970M reaches 3,663 in the G3D Mark benchmark — just a 0.4% difference, making them near-identical in rasterization performance. The P104-100 is built on Pascal while the Radeon HD 7970M uses GCN 1.0, both on 16 nm vs 28 nm. Shader units: 1,920 (P104-100) vs 1,280 (Radeon HD 7970M). Raw compute: 6.655 TFLOPS (P104-100) vs 2.176 TFLOPS (Radeon HD 7970M).
